Bush Picks Wolfowitz for New World Bank President
By Adam Entous
WASHINGTON (Reuters) - President George W. Bush on Wednesday chose Deputy
Defense Secretary Paul Wolfowitz, a lightning rod of controversy as an
architect of the Iraq war, to become the new president of the World Bank.
The selection threatened to set off a bitter fight on the World Bank board,
which must sign off on Washington's choice, at a time when Bush has said
improving transatlantic relations and America's image in the Arab world
will be top priorities.

From Wikipedia:
"George W. Bush has nominated Paul Wolfowitz, a well-known conservative
and current United States Deputy Secretary of Defense to replace Mr.
Wolfensohn [as president of the World Bank]. By convention, the Bank
president is always a US citizen, just as the Managing Director of the
IMF is a European, but there is no requirement that a nomination by the
United States government must be accepted by European partners. As
Michel Barnier, French Foreign Minister has commented: 'It's a
proposal. We shall examine it in the context of the personality of the
person you mention and perhaps in view of other candidates.'"
